Trūkstošu Facebook e-pasta adrešu noslēpuma atrisināšana

Trūkstošu Facebook e-pasta adrešu noslēpuma atrisināšana
Facebook

Facebook e-pasta dilemmas atrisināšana

Integrējot Facebook pieteikšanās sistēmu lietojumprogrammā, izstrādātāji bieži vien paredz nemanāmu lietotāja datu, tostarp e-pasta adrešu, izgūšanu pēc nepieciešamo atļauju pieņemšanas. Tomēr rodas mulsinošs scenārijs, kad e-pasta lauks, kas ir paredzēts aizpildīt ar lietotāja e-pasta adresi, atgriež nulli, neskatoties uz to, ka lietotājs piešķir "e-pasta" atļauju. Šī problēma ne tikai mulsina izstrādātājus, bet arī apgrūtina lietotāju pieredzi, liekot kritiski izpētīt pamatcēloņus un iespējamos risinājumus.

Šis izaicinājums prasa dziļāku izpratni par Facebook Graph API un tās atļauju sistēmu. Scenārijs uzsver, cik svarīgi ir ievērot Facebook datu piekļuves protokolus un rūpīgas atkļūdošanas nepieciešamību. Tas arī izceļ lietotāju privātuma un datu aizsardzības mainīgo ainavu, mudinot izstrādātājus rūpīgi pārvietoties pa šiem ūdeņiem. Iedziļinoties šīs problēmas specifikā, ir svarīgi paturēt prātā plašāku ietekmi uz lietojumprogrammu izstrādi un lietotāju datu drošību.

Kāpēc zinātnieki vairs neuzticas atomiem?Jo tie veido visu!

Pavēli Apraksts
Graph API Explorer Rīks Graph API pieprasījumu testēšanai un atkļūdošanai, tostarp atļauju validācijai.
FB.login() JavaScript SDK metode Facebook pieteikšanās iniciēšanai ar atzvanīšanu, lai apstrādātu atbildi.
FB.api() Metode Graph API izsaukšanai, kad lietotājs ir autentificēts, ko izmanto lietotāja datu izgūšanai.

Trūkstošo e-pasta adrešu atkļūdošana pakalpojumā Facebook

JavaScript SDK

<script>
  FB.init({
    appId      : 'your-app-id',
    cookie     : true,
    xfbml      : true,
    version    : 'v9.0'
  });
</script>
<script>
  FB.login(function(response) {
    if (response.authResponse) {
      console.log('Welcome!  Fetching your information.... ');
      FB.api('/me', {fields: 'name,email'}, function(response) {
        console.log('Good to see you, ' + response.name + '.');
        console.log('Email: ' + response.email);
      });
    } else {
      console.log('User cancelled login or did not fully authorize.');
    }
  }, {scope: 'email'});
</script>

Risinājumu izpēte Facebook nulles e-pasta problēmai

Viena no mulsinošajām problēmām, ar ko saskaras izstrādātāji, integrējot Facebook pieteikšanos savās lietojumprogrammās, ir scenārijs, kurā e-pasta lauks atgriež nulli, neskatoties uz to, ka lietotājs piešķir "e-pasta" atļauju. Šī problēma bieži rodas dažādu iemeslu dēļ, kas nav uzreiz pamanāmi, kā rezultātā ir rūpīgi jāizpēta un jāizprot Facebook API un atļauju sistēma. Galvenais iemesls var būt no lietotājiem, kuriem Facebook kontā nav iestatīts primārais e-pasts, un beidzot ar konfidencialitātes iestatījumiem, kas ierobežo piekļuvi e-pasta adresei. Turklāt Facebook platformas izmaiņas un atjauninājumi var izraisīt arī neparedzētu rīcību attiecībā uz datu piekļuves atļaujām.

Lai efektīvi risinātu šo problēmu, izstrādātājiem vispirms ir jānodrošina, lai viņu lietojumprogramma pieteikšanās procesa laikā nepārprotami pieprasītu e-pasta atļauju. Facebook Graph API Explorer izmantošana var palīdzēt pārbaudīt un atkļūdot ar atļaujām saistītas problēmas. Turklāt ļoti svarīgi ir izprast Facebook privātuma iestatījumu nianses un to, kā tie ietekmē lietotāja datu redzamību. Izstrādātājiem vajadzētu arī apsvērt iespēju ieviest rezerves mehānismus, piemēram, mudināt lietotājus manuāli ievadīt savu e-pasta adresi, ja to nevar izgūt automātiski. Saglabājot jaunāko informāciju par Facebook izstrādātāju dokumentāciju un piedaloties izstrādātāju kopienās, varat iegūt ieskatu un atjauninājumus, kā efektīvāk risināt šādas problēmas.

Iedziļināties Facebook e-pasta izguves jautājumā

Izaicinājums izgūt e-pasta adreses no Facebook pieteikšanās API ir nozīmīgs šķērslis izstrādātājiem, kas norāda uz sarežģītu lietotāju atļauju, privātuma iestatījumu un API funkcionalitātes mijiedarbību. Šīs problēmas pamatā ir digitālās privātuma niansētais raksturs un mehānismi, ko izmanto tādas platformas kā Facebook, lai aizsargātu lietotāju datus. Izstrādātājiem ir rūpīgi jāpārvietojas šajos ūdeņos, līdzsvarojot lietotāju datu nepieciešamību un privātuma ievērošanu. Problēma bieži vien nav tik vienkārša kā trūkstošs kods vai vienkārša kļūda; tas ir iegults veidā, kā Facebook pārvalda lietotāja datus un atļaujas. Šī konteksta izpratne ir ļoti svarīga izstrādātājiem, kuri vēlas savās lietojumprogrammās nemanāmi integrēt Facebook pieteikšanās funkciju.

Šīs problēmas mazināšanas stratēģijas ietver uzlabotu kļūdu apstrādi, lietotāju izglītošanu un alternatīvas datu izguves metodes. Izstrādātāji var ieviest pielāgotus kļūdu ziņojumus, kas informē lietotājus par iespējamiem iemesliem, kāpēc viņu e-pasta adrese netiek kopīgota, un palīdz viņiem veikt konfidencialitātes iestatījumu atjaunināšanas procesu. Turklāt, izveidojot funkciju, kas lietotājiem ļauj manuāli ievadīt savu e-pasta adresi kā atkāpšanos, var palīdzēt uzlabot lietotāja pieredzi un datu vākšanas efektivitāti. Būtiski ir arī sekot līdzi Facebook API atjauninājumiem un izmaiņām, jo ​​tas, kas darbojas šodien, var nedarboties rīt. Sadarbošanās ar izstrādātāju kopienu, izmantojot forumus un sociālos saziņas līdzekļus, var sniegt ieskatu un kopīgu pieredzi, kas ir nenovērtējama problēmu novēršanā un praktisku risinājumu meklēšanā.

Bieži uzdotie jautājumi par Facebook e-pasta izgūšanu

  1. Jautājums: Kāpēc Facebook e-pasta lauks atgriež nulli pat pēc e-pasta atļaujas piešķiršanas?
  2. Atbilde: Tas var notikt privātuma iestatījumu dēļ, lietotājam, kam nav galvenā e-pasta pakalpojumā Facebook, vai izmaiņām Facebook API un platformas atjauninājumos.
  3. Jautājums: Kā izstrādātāji var nodrošināt, ka viņi saņem e-pasta adresi Facebook pieteikšanās laikā?
  4. Atbilde: Izstrādātājiem pieteikšanās procesa laikā ir skaidri jāpieprasa e-pasta atļauja un tā jāpārbauda, ​​izmantojot Facebook Graph API Explorer.
  5. Jautājums: Kas izstrādātājiem jādara, ja e-pasta adrese netiek izgūta?
  6. Atbilde: Ieviesiet atkāpšanās mehānismus, piemēram, aiciniet lietotāju manuāli ievadīt savu e-pastu vai atkārtoti apmeklējiet atļauju pieprasījumu plūsmu.
  7. Jautājums: Kā izmaiņas Facebook privātuma politikā var ietekmēt e-pasta izguvi?
  8. Atbilde: Konfidencialitātes politiku atjauninājumi var ierobežot piekļuvi lietotāju datiem, liekot izstrādātājiem attiecīgi pielāgot savu datu vākšanas praksi.
  9. Jautājums: Vai ir kāds veids, kā pārbaudīt un atkļūdot e-pasta atļauju problēmas?
  10. Atbilde: Jā, izmantojot Facebook Graph API Explorer, izstrādātāji var pārbaudīt atļaujas un nodrošināt pareizu datu izgūšanu.
  11. Jautājums: Vai lietotāja iestatījumi pakalpojumā Facebook var novērst e-pasta kopīgošanu?
  12. Atbilde: Jā, lietotāji var konfigurēt savus konfidencialitātes iestatījumus, lai ierobežotu to, kāda informācija tiek kopīgota ar trešo pušu lietojumprogrammām, tostarp viņu e-pasta adrese.
  13. Jautājums: Cik bieži notiek Facebook API un platformas atjauninājumi?
  14. Atbilde: Facebook periodiski atjaunina savu API un platformu, kas var ietekmēt datu izguves metodes. Izstrādātājiem jābūt informētiem, izmantojot oficiālo dokumentāciju un kopienas forumus.
  15. Jautājums: Kādi resursi ir pieejami izstrādātājiem, kuriem ir problēmas ar e-pasta izguvi?
  16. Atbilde: Facebook izstrādātāju dokumentācija, kopienas forumi un Graph API Explorer ir vērtīgi resursi problēmu novēršanai un atbalstam.
  17. Jautājums: Kā izstrādātāji var atbildīgi rīkoties ar lietotāja datiem, integrējot Facebook pieteikšanos?
  18. Atbilde: Izstrādātājiem ir jāievēro Facebook vadlīnijas, jāievēro lietotāju privātums un jāievieš droša datu apstrādes prakse, lai aizsargātu lietotāja informāciju.

Facebook e-pasta mīklas iesaiņošana

E-pasta adrešu izgūšanas sarežģījumi, izmantojot Facebook pieteikšanos, izstrādātājiem rada daudzšķautņainu izaicinājumu, kas ir pamatā delikātam līdzsvaram starp lietotāju privātumu un piekļuvi datiem. Šī izpēte atklāj izplatītākos šķēršļus un stratēģiskās pieejas to pārvarēšanai, uzsverot skaidru atļauju pieprasījumu, stingras kļūdu apstrādes un alternatīvu lietotāju datu izguves metožu nozīmi. Facebook API un privātuma politiku dinamiskais raksturs prasa proaktīvu un informētu pieeju integrācijai, mudinot izstrādātājus saglabāt modrību un pielāgoties. Sadarbošanās ar izstrādātāju kopienu un resursu, piemēram, Facebook Graph API Explorer, izmantošana ir nenovērtējama, lai pārvarētu šīs problēmas. Galu galā ļoti svarīgi ir ievērot lietotāju privātumu, vienlaikus nodrošinot nevainojamu lietojumprogrammu pieredzi, veicinot uzticēšanos un atbilstību digitālajai ekosistēmai. Ceļojums caur atkļūdošanu un Facebook pieteikšanās integrācijas pilnveidošanu uzsver tīmekļa izstrādes ainavas attīstību, kurā pielāgošanās spēja un uz lietotāju orientētas pieejas noved pie panākumiem.